High Energy Bills From HVAC in Half Moon Bay
A bill that climbs while comfort stays about the same usually means the system is working harder to do the same job, not that you are using more heating or cooling than before. A dirty condenser coil, a weak capacitor, a slow refrigerant leak, or leaky ductwork all make the equipment run longer and draw more power for the same result. Common causes
Dirty or fouled condenser coil. A coil that cannot reject heat properly forces the compressor to run longer for the same amount of cooling. The salt-laden coastal air here corrodes contacts, terminals, and coils noticeably faster than an inland climate would. That accelerates the fouling here.
Weak or failing run capacitor. A capacitor on its way out makes the compressor and fan motors work harder to start and run, drawing more current than a healthy system for the same output.
Low refrigerant from a slow leak. An undercharged system runs longer to reach the same setpoint, and it can also freeze the coil, which makes the problem worse and the bill higher still.
Leaky ductwork. Ducts that leak into an attic, crawlspace, or garage lose conditioned air before it ever reaches a room. Older coastal homes here often have returns and duct runs sized for a mild climate that never expected much run time. It's a common source we check on every high-bill call.
Aging equipment running past its efficient life. Equipment does not need to be broken to run inefficiently. Older units lose efficiency gradually as bearings, coils, and refrigerant circuits wear, well before an outright failure.
How we diagnose it
- Amp draw on the compressor and fan motor against the nameplate, to catch a unit working harder than it should.
- Capacitor capacitance with a meter, plus contactor condition. The salt-laden coastal air here corrodes contacts, terminals, and coils noticeably faster than an inland climate would.
- Refrigerant pressures and the indoor temperature split, to spot an undercharge or iced coil.
- Outdoor coil and fin condition for fouling that quietly kills efficiency.
- Duct leakage, especially in the attic and under-floor runs. Older coastal homes here often have returns and duct runs sized for a mild climate that never expected much run time.
